commit 64cdf302eee1172242fb3a76ec8f2ac3bb75d6cb Author: Adar Dembo <[email protected]> AuthorDate: Fri Apr 19 09:57:39 2019 -0700 hybrid_clock: use different message when injecting errors The "Clock considered unsynchronized" error message is special in that if its in the test log, report-test.sh will skip reporting. So let's make sure it's not naturally occurring in any tests. Without this change, hybrid_clock-test never reported any results.
